SpletSome facts about long sentences. Jonathan Coe's novel, 'The Rotters' Club', contains a sentence of 13,955 words. This is generally considered to be the longest sentence in English literature. One of Molly Bloom's soliloquies in James Joyce's epic novel 'Ulysses' features a sentence of 4,491 words. The Guinness Book of Records lists the longest ... The longest place name in Wales can be found on the Isle of Anglesey which is an island off the coast of North Wales.
